'It's Not Cute to be Financially Illiterate': Anne Hathaway and Meryl Streep Recall the Moment They Realized They'd Never Rely on Anyone for Money

Women have long been portrayed in pop culture as consumers of wealth, but that narrative is shifting as financial confidence and decision-making power grow. A CFP Board report shows nearly 70% of women now serve as their household's primary investment decision-maker, reflecting broader gains in financial confidence and influence.
